The Amazing Appeal of Antique Carriage Lamps: A Glimpse into History

Vintage carriage lamps are some of the very adored and sought-after timepieces on earth of horology. Noted for antique clock sales, historic significance, and style, these lamps serve as a testament to the beauty and accuracy of past eras. Frequently associated with the 19th century, these lightweight timepieces were formerly made to be moved by tourists, thus the title “carriage clock.” Today, they symbolize not just a useful little bit of record but in addition a prized collectible.

What Makes Classic Carriage Clocks Particular?

Classic carriage lamps stand out due to their different style, which regularly includes a metal or gilded steel case, a glass entrance, and an elaborate dial. Many are adorned with delightful outlining, creating them creatively fascinating even for individuals with no unique fascination with timepieces. Some models offer great enamel function, while others are embellished with decorative engravings or even little paintings. What really sets these lamps apart, but, is the technical movement inside, that is usually meticulously constructed by competent artisans.

These lamps are normally driven by a spring-driven system, which involves rotating, and they generally have a striking function, like a bell or chime, to attentive the user to the time. Antique carriage lamps is found in a variety of types, but the most popular ones in many cases are from France, that has been the epicenter of clockmaking through the 19th century.
